引言
随着信息技术的飞速发展,企业对信息安全的重视程度日益提高。软件权限管理作为信息安全的重要组成部分,其重要性不言而喻。本文将深入探讨高效软件权限管理的策略,帮助企业在轻松设置的同时,确保信息安全与合规操作。
一、软件权限管理的概述
1.1 定义
软件权限管理是指对软件系统中用户和用户组所拥有的权限进行有效控制的过程。通过权限管理,企业可以确保只有授权的用户才能访问特定的资源和功能。
1.2 权限管理的目的
- 保护企业信息资产,防止未授权访问和滥用。
- 确保合规操作,符合相关法律法规和行业标准。
- 提高工作效率,简化用户操作流程。
二、高效软件权限管理的策略
2.1 明确权限需求
在实施权限管理之前,首先要明确企业的权限需求。这包括:
- 分析业务流程,确定不同角色和岗位的权限需求。
- 识别敏感数据和关键功能,确保相关权限的严格控制。
2.2 建立权限模型
根据权限需求,建立合理的权限模型。常见的权限模型包括:
- 基于角色的访问控制(RBAC):根据用户角色分配权限。
- 基于属性的访问控制(ABAC):根据用户属性(如部门、职位等)分配权限。
- 基于任务的访问控制(TBAC):根据用户任务分配权限。
2.3 权限分配与回收
- 权限分配:根据权限模型,将相应权限分配给用户或用户组。
- 权限回收:在用户离职或岗位变动时,及时回收其权限。
2.4 权限审计与监控
- 权限审计:定期对权限进行审计,确保权限分配的合理性和合规性。
- 权限监控:实时监控用户行为,及时发现异常操作。
2.5 权限管理工具与技术
- 权限管理工具:选择合适的权限管理工具,提高管理效率。
- 权限管理技术:采用先进的技术,如加密、身份认证等,确保权限安全。
三、案例分析
以下是一个基于RBAC的权限管理案例:
3.1 案例背景
某企业采用ERP系统进行业务管理,系统包含销售、采购、财务等模块。
3.2 权限需求分析
- 销售人员:访问销售模块,进行订单处理、客户管理等操作。
- 采购人员:访问采购模块,进行采购订单、供应商管理等操作。
- 财务人员:访问财务模块,进行账务处理、报表分析等操作。
3.3 权限模型建立
采用RBAC模型,根据角色分配权限:
- 销售角色:销售模块的完全访问权限。
- 采购角色:采购模块的完全访问权限。
- 财务角色:财务模块的完全访问权限。
3.4 权限分配与回收
根据岗位需求,将相应权限分配给用户。用户离职或岗位变动时,及时回收其权限。
3.5 权限审计与监控
定期进行权限审计,确保权限分配的合理性和合规性。实时监控用户行为,及时发现异常操作。
四、总结
高效软件权限管理是保障信息安全与合规操作的关键。通过明确权限需求、建立权限模型、权限分配与回收、权限审计与监控以及选择合适的权限管理工具与技术,企业可以轻松设置,确保信息安全与合规操作。
